Traffic Congestion Rises in Kathmandu as Election Nears; Election Police Deployed for Management

Summary

Traffic congestion in Kathmandu is worsening as elections approach, prompting deployment of election police to manage road traffic and ensure smooth movement.

Key Points
  • Traffic congestion in Kathmandu Valley is rising as elections near.
  • Regular traffic police have been deployed outside the valley for election security.
  • Traffic management difficulties have emerged at various intersections in Kathmandu.
  • Election police are now deployed to help manage traffic and clear jams.
